ICE canola drops as China imposes anti-dumping duty

Glacier FarmMedia — ICE canola futures were sharply lower Tuesday morning as China announced a preliminary anti-dumping duty of 75.8 per cent on Canadian canola imports. Canadian Financial Close: C$ weaker Monday

Glacier FarmMedia — The Canadian dollar was weaker on Monday, hitting its weakest level in six days relative to its United States counterpart. The Canadian dollar settled at US$0.7254 or US$1=C$1.3785, which compares with Friday’s close of US$0.7272 or US$1=C$1.3751.
